Press Release

15th July 2010
PC-based Control: TwinCAT Solar Position Algorithm software library optimise solar energy harvesting
High-precision PC-based solar tracking
The TwinCAT Solar Position Algorithm software function block from Beckhoff enables exact calculation of sun angles anywhere in the world at any time, without the use of sensors. This flexible solution is ideal for parabolic mirror and photovoltaic systems as well as for other solar power plant designs that automatically track the sun's position for optimum utilisation of the sun's rays. The control algorithm, which calculates sun angles with a precision of ±0.001°, can also be used for other applications such as in building automation or with wind turbines for shadow flicker calculations.

The TwinCAT Solar Position Algorithm software library enables high-precision determination of sun angles and the times for sunrise, solar noon and sunset year-round. The calculation of the sun angles with the TwinCAT library simply requires the specification of the date, time and exact longitude and latitude of the location (e.g. through a GPS system). Depending on the required precision the algorithm can take into account additional parameters such as the time zone, the height above mean sea level, the slope of the ground or the orientation of the object, the air temperature and pressure, which influence atmospheric refraction. The algorithm can achieve an impressive precision of ±0.001°.

Areas of application include parabolic mirror systems with focusing mirrors of several meters diameter, which track the sun with great accuracy in order to focus the sun’s rays in an ideal focal point. This requires high-precision measurement of the sun angles. Photovoltaic installations that track the sun position also operate on this basis. Another area of application is building automation, where sensors alone are no longer sufficient to adequately deal with shading of large building facades. The Beckhoff software can also be used for exact calculation of shadow flicker from wind turbines, which is to be avoided in populated areas. The results allow individual turbines to be switched off if necessary.

Press picture

  • The TwinCAT Solar Position Algorithm software function block enables high-precision calculation of the sun angles anywhere in the world at any time. This flexible solution is ideal for parabolic mirror and photovoltaic systems that track the sun’s position as well as for shadow flicker calculations generated for wind turbines.

    Picture caption:

    The TwinCAT Solar Position Algorithm software function block enables high-precision calculation of the sun angles anywhere in the world at any time. This flexible solution is ideal for parabolic mirror and photovoltaic systems that track the sun’s position as well as for shadow flicker calculations generated for wind turbines.

Back to overview